When it comes to storytelling, very few pop groups have done it as well as Squeeze. But even the group’s songwriting mainstays Chris Difford and Glenn Tilbrook would be hard pushed to devise a plot twist like the one that has resulted in Trixies, their first album in eight years. Because, if truth be told, the band who have given us sky-high classics such as ‘Up The Junction’, ‘Tempted’, ‘Cool For Cats’, ‘Another Nail In My Heart’ and ‘Labelled With Love’ weren’t planning another album. And that was ok. They’d scaled the highs of pop stardom; they’d disbanded and reconvened; fallen out and made up. Along the way, they got to bear witness to the effect their songbook has had on generations of fans – their compositions covered by artists as disparate as Erykah Badu, Tricky, Patti Austin, The Shins, Joe Cocker, The Lathums and Questlove & Robert Glasper. Their songs even pop up from time to time on Desert Island Discs, most recently when comedian Bob Mortimer revealed that he had already requested that the title track of their 1993 album Some Fantastic Place be played at his funeral. Adam Ant, one of the defining musicians of the new wave will be touring North America this summer, extending a legacy that stretches back to the heady days of punk. A native of central London, Adam Ant became obsessed with music as a kid, hearing all types of rock n roll and pop on the radio. When he was 12, he learned to play bass, adding guitar to his repertoire by the time he formed Adam & The Ants. Adam began reclaiming his musical legacy in the 2000s, earning a Q Music Icon Award in 2008. After releasing Adam Ant Is The Blueblack Hussar In Marrying the Gunner's Daughter, his first album of new material in 18 years, in 2013, he returned to the road, shining the spotlight at different eras in his career by performing Dirk Wears White Sox, Kings of the Wild Frontier and Friend or Foe in their entirety.
